Transaction d8de31b79f36e0109f9181d749c60758e6526e1e645bdbd85caa29dc2186a711

1 Input
2 Outputs
  • d8de31b79f36e0109f9181d749c60758e6526e1e645bdbd85caa29dc2186a711:0
  • value  46585
    address  3DCiJjiEsz9Y2eYYBF3UwNRvJdUjLaan7o
  • d8de31b79f36e0109f9181d749c60758e6526e1e645bdbd85caa29dc2186a711:1
  • value  6142958
    address  16D7A25J2DP39RaJ7x8q3Wt9XnqHZhkTL5